@@ -0,0 +1,100 @@
|
||||
function toBeValidCoordinate(coord) {
|
||||
// coordinate must have two dimensions
|
||||
if (!Array.isArray(coord) || coord.length !== 2) {
|
||||
return {
|
||||
pass: false,
|
||||
message: `coordinate must have two dimensions`,
|
||||
};
|
||||
}
|
||||
|
||||
// coordinate dimensions must be valid numbers
|
||||
if (
|
||||
typeof coord[0] !== 'number' ||
|
||||
isNaN(coord[0]) ||
|
||||
typeof coord[1] !== 'number' ||
|
||||
isNaN(coord[1])
|
||||
) {
|
||||
return {
|
||||
pass: false,
|
||||
message: `coordinate dimensions must be valid numbers`,
|
||||
};
|
||||
}
|
||||
|
||||
// coordinate valid
|
||||
return {
|
||||
pass: true,
|
||||
message: `coordinate valid`,
|
||||
};
|
||||
}
|
||||
|
||||
function toBeValidBounds(bounds) {
|
||||
// null bounds are valid
|
||||
if (bounds === null) {
|
||||
return {
|
||||
pass: true,
|
||||
message: `null bounds are valid`,
|
||||
};
|
||||
}
|
||||
|
||||
// bounds must be a coordinate pair
|
||||
if (!Array.isArray(bounds) || bounds.length !== 2) {
|
||||
return {
|
||||
pass: false,
|
||||
message: `bounds must be a coordinate pair`,
|
||||
};
|
||||
}
|
||||
|
||||
// validate south-west
|
||||
const validateSW = toBeValidCoordinate(bounds[0]);
|
||||
if (!validateSW.pass) {
|
||||
return validateSW;
|
||||
}
|
||||
|
||||
// validate north-east
|
||||
const validateNE = toBeValidCoordinate(bounds[1]);
|
||||
if (!validateNE.pass) {
|
||||
return validateNE;
|
||||
}
|
||||
|
||||
// corners
|
||||
const [south, west] = bounds[0];
|
||||
const [north, east] = bounds[1];
|
||||
|
||||
// bounds represents a point
|
||||
// note: this is not really a valid bounds but we will allow it
|
||||
if (south === north && west === east) {
|
||||
return {
|
||||
pass: true,
|
||||
message: `bounds represents a point`,
|
||||
};
|
||||
}
|
||||
|
||||
// west should be less than or equal to east
|
||||
// @note: this is not the strictly case for bounds which cross the antimeridian
|
||||
if (west > east) {
|
||||
return {
|
||||
pass: false,
|
||||
message: `west should be less than or equal to east`,
|
||||
};
|
||||
}
|
||||
|
||||
// south should be less than or equal to north
|
||||
// @note: this is not the strictly case for bounds which cross a pole
|
||||
if (south > north) {
|
||||
return {
|
||||
pass: false,
|
||||
message: `south should be less than or equal to north`,
|
||||
};
|
||||
}
|
||||
|
||||
// bounds valid
|
||||
return {
|
||||
pass: true,
|
||||
message: `bounds valid`,
|
||||
};
|
||||
}
|
||||
|
||||
expect.extend({
|
||||
toBeValidCoordinate,
|
||||
toBeValidBounds,
|
||||
});
